California and San Diego STD Incidence Rates
Every year, the Federal Government and the California department of health collect information and incident rates on Sexually Transmitted Diseases in your area. The info is intended as a reference tool so you can gauge your STD risks. Fast facts about STD infection rates in San Diego and / or California:
- The number of reported occurrences of HIV in California in 2008: 5161 (a 30% increase)
- San Diego Gonorrhea rate per 100,000 people: 57.8
- The amount of reported Chlamydia cases in San Diego and San Diego County in 2008: 14343
- San Diego Chlamydia rate per 100,000 individuals: 447
- The number of reported Syphilis occurrences in San Diego and San Diego County in 2008: 136
- San Diego Syphilis rate per 100,000: 4.2
As you can see, STDs are a growing problem in San Diego, California and nationally. Always protect yourself by practicing safe sex.
